A NAVAL DISASTER.
60 .JAPANESE SAILORS DROWNED. . Received lit, 9.15 p.m. Tokio, December 10. During a squall at Shinagwa, sampans conveying 95 bluejackets, belonging to the cruiser Chitose, capsized and ri 0 were drowned. Received 11,12.15 a.m. Tokio, December 10 I The accident to the members of th» Chitose crew occurred at Shanghai.
